Dr. Jay Calvert, MD, FACS Joins With Other Surgeons to Create Surgical Friends Foundation


Currently there are millions of people all over the world who are afflicted with acquired, congenital or post traumatic physical deformities, however due to lack of monetary funds or access to quality health care, they continue to suffer with their deformities and never get proper medical help. The vision of the founding members of Surgical Friends Foundation is to unite a team that would reach out to all those suffering from physical deformities and give them access to quality medical care.

Surgical Friends Foundation aims to bring philanthropists, surgeons and other medical professionals together to help patients, from any part of the world, who are suffering from life-threatening reconstructive cases and do not have access to proper medical procedures or equipments. Another goal of the organization is to equip and educate medical teams from all developing countries with new surgical techniques that could potentially help save lives.

“I was asked to be involved in Surgical Friends by Dr. Kami Parsa, who has a tremendous passion for correcting these problems for patients from around the world,” shared Dr. Calvert when asked why he decided to join the Foundation. “We’re donating our care, we’re donating our time, and we believe that’s [going to] make a difference, and if it’s one patient at a time then so be it,” Dr. Calvert added, “But I think it’s an attitude about healthcare that’s really [going to] lead Surgical Friends to a different level.” Dr. Calvert offers his expertise in plastic surgery and rhinoplasty to help patients achieve facial harmony.

The goal to make a difference is what makes Surgical Friends a unique philanthropic activity. As more and more children are born with congenital defects like pediatric deformities, missing limbs and cleft palate, the demand for proper medical attention has risen as well. Dr. Calvert and the rest of the team help alleviate this demand by offering their medical expertise and surgical services for free to those who need them most.

Dr. Jay Calvert received his Medical Degree at the Cornell University Medical College in New York and completed his residency training in General and Plastic Surgery at the University of Pittsburg in Pennsylvania. Certified by the American Board of Plastic Surgery, he performs all types of plastic surgery and specializes in aesthetic surgery and rhinoplasty. Dr. Calvert practices in Beverly Hills and Orange County, California and is one of the co-founders of Surgical Friends Foundation.
